Alberto Cano Huerta has been competing for 11 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 9.63, set at Albacete Cubea y Vete 2025, puts him in the top 6.4%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 265th in Spain. Until November 2007, no official 3×3 solve in the world had been that fast. Across 6 competitions since February 2016, he has put 231 official solves on the record across eight events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 15% around a typical one; 83% of the 35,811 competitors with ten or more counted rounds hold a tighter spread. That figure sets aside his 5 DNFs. His 3×3 best has come down from 13.55 in February 2016 to 9.63, a 29% improvement. Alberto has entered six competitions, more competitions than 86%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
